P6项目管理软件资源导入导出:操作流程与最佳实践详解
在现代项目管理中,Primavera P6 是全球广泛使用的专业项目管理工具,尤其适用于大型复杂项目。其强大的资源管理功能可以帮助项目经理精确分配人力、设备和材料等关键资源。然而,随着项目规模的扩大或组织架构的变化,频繁地进行资源数据的导入与导出成为常态。正确掌握 P6 资源导入导出的操作方法不仅能够提升工作效率,还能避免因格式错误或数据不一致导致的项目延误。
一、为什么要进行资源导入导出?
资源是项目执行的核心要素之一。在 P6 中,资源可以是人员、设备、材料或成本项。它们决定了任务的持续时间、预算和进度安排。常见的导入导出场景包括:
- 跨项目复用资源库:当多个项目使用相似资源时,可将一个项目的资源批量导出并导入到其他项目中,减少重复录入工作。
- 与HR系统集成:企业常将人力资源系统(如SAP、Workday)的数据导出为Excel格式后,再导入P6以同步最新员工信息和可用性。
- 备份与迁移:在系统升级或更换服务器时,需提前导出所有资源配置,确保数据完整迁移。
- 审计与合规:定期导出资源数据可用于内部审计、财务对账或满足行业监管要求。
二、P6资源导入导出的基本流程
1. 准备阶段:数据整理与格式校验
导入前必须确保源数据符合P6的要求。通常使用Excel作为中间媒介,建议创建一个标准模板文件,包含以下字段:
| 字段名称 | 说明 | 是否必填 |
|---|---|---|
| Resource ID | 唯一标识符,用于区分不同资源 | 是 |
| Resource Name | 资源名称,如“工程师张三” | 是 |
| Resource Type | 类型:Labor(人工)、Material(材料)、Equipment(设备) | 是 |
| Cost Rate | 单位成本费率,如每小时薪资 | 否(若未设置,则按默认值处理) |
| Available Hours/Week | 每周可用工时数,影响任务工期估算 | 是 |
| Description | 备注信息,便于识别用途 | 否 |
注意:不要修改列顺序,否则可能导致导入失败;数值型字段应避免文本格式,以免解析异常。
2. 导入资源:通过“Import Resources”功能实现
步骤如下:
- 打开P6客户端,进入Resources模块。
- 点击菜单栏中的File → Import → Resources。
- 选择已准备好的Excel文件(.xlsx),点击Open。
- 系统会自动检测文件结构,显示预览窗口。此时可查看是否有缺失字段或非法字符。
- 确认无误后,点击Import按钮完成导入。
- 导入完成后,可在资源列表中看到新增的资源条目,并可通过筛选器快速定位。
3. 导出资源:保存当前资源配置
若需将当前项目的所有资源导出为Excel文件以便存档或共享:
- 在Resources界面中,点击Export → Resources。
- 选择导出范围:可以选择全部资源或基于特定条件(如某个部门、资源类型)。
- 指定导出格式为Microsoft Excel (.xlsx)。
- 设定保存路径并命名文件,例如:
Project_X_Resources_20251204.xlsx。 - 点击Export开始导出,完成后即可发送给团队成员或归档。
三、常见问题及解决方案
问题1:导入提示“Invalid Data Format”
原因:源Excel文件存在非数字内容在数值列(如成本率写成了“未知”),或者日期格式不符合P6要求(如“2025/12/04”而非“2025-12-04”)。
解决办法:使用Excel的查找替换功能清除无效字符;统一日期格式为ISO标准(YYYY-MM-DD);必要时先将数据复制到新工作表中重新整理。
问题2:资源导入后无法分配到任务
原因:可能是资源未启用“Assignable”属性,或该资源类型未被任务定义所支持(如任务仅允许分配Labor资源,但导入的是Equipment)。
解决办法:在资源编辑界面检查Assignable选项是否勾选;同时确认任务的Resource Assignment规则是否匹配资源类型。
问题3:导入大量资源时出现超时错误
原因:一次性导入超过1000条记录可能触发数据库连接超时,尤其是在低带宽网络环境下。
解决办法:分批导入,每次控制在500条以内;或联系IT部门调整数据库连接参数(如增加timeout值);优先使用增量更新方式而非全量导入。
四、高级技巧与最佳实践
1. 使用模板化导入提升效率
建立一套标准化的Excel模板(含公式、下拉菜单、条件格式),可显著降低人为错误。例如,在“Resource Type”列设置下拉选项(Labor / Material / Equipment),防止拼写错误。
2. 利用P6 API进行自动化导入
对于高频次、大批量的数据交换,建议开发脚本调用P6的Web Services API(SOAP/XML-RPC)实现自动化导入。这适用于与ERP、HR系统对接的场景,极大减少人工干预。
3. 导入前后做差异对比
导入完成后,建议生成一份资源清单比对报告,列出新增、修改、删除的资源项,便于追溯变更历史。可借助Excel的VLOOKUP函数或Power Query实现自动化比对。
4. 设置版本控制机制
将导出的资源文件纳入版本控制系统(如Git或SharePoint),每次导入都保留一个快照,方便回滚至历史状态。
五、总结与建议
掌握P6项目管理软件资源导入导出的方法,不仅是技术层面的技能,更是项目管理精细化的重要体现。通过规范化的流程、合理的数据准备以及有效的故障排查策略,可以大幅提升项目启动阶段的资源配置效率。建议项目团队制定《资源导入导出操作手册》,明确责任人、审批流程和常见问题处理指南,形成制度化管理。
未来,随着AI驱动的智能项目管理系统兴起,P6也将逐步融合更多自动化能力。提前熟悉资源导入导出机制,有助于更好地适应数字化转型趋势,为项目成功奠定坚实基础。





